Learning Outcomes

ILO 1 Establish a design of structural steel members of a fixed offshore structure

ILO 2 Apply appropriate engineering analysis and design methods for reinforced concrete beam structure

ILO 3 Correctly select and apply experimental and analytical methods to identify, characterize and classify soil and concrete material properties in accordance to industry standards and procedures

ILO 4 Evaluate a suitable design of structural foundations and anchoring systems for given soil and loading condition
